锯切花岗石过程中金刚石承受载荷分析

摘    要:通过检测锯切水平力、垂直力以及功率消耗,研究了花岗石锯切过程中单颗磨粒承受的平均法向力特征,并探讨了节块中金刚石出露高度分布状态和锯切水槽对磨粒实际承受载荷的影响.研究结果对加工参数优化和金刚石工具设计具有参考价值.

关 键 词:金刚石  花岗石  锯切  单颗磨粒承受力

Load Analysis on Diamond Grits in Circular Sawing during Cutting Granites

Abstract:The average normal force per diamond grain is analyzed by measuring the horizontal and vertical force components and the power in circular sawing of granite with segmented diamond blade. The influences of diamond protrusion beyond bond matrix and the presence of coolant slots on the actual normal force per grain are discussed. The results presented in this paper can serve as a useful guideline for the selection of optimal machining parameters and optimal design of diamond tools.
Keywords:diamond  granite  sawing  normal force per grain
